Hi Spinners,

I'm not sure what the file types for Third wire are, but tga files are also used for Targetware. I've found that when saving in .tga format, a box pops up asking about "RLE compression" and "Origin at bottom left". I make sure both of these check boxes are not checked. Perhaps that may help you out.
